General Borrowing Policies and Procedures for students, faculty members, employees and alumni

A. Undergraduate Students
Undergraduate students are allowed to borrow three (3) books for a week, renewable once only for Filipiniana and Circulation books.
Theses are STRICTLY for ROOM USE - Only. Only abstracts & bibliographies are allowed to be photocopied.
Instructional Media Materials, Vertical File Materials and books from the General Reference Section are also STRICTLY for ROOM USE - Only.
Students who are also faculty members can borrow five (5) books.
B. Faculty Members
Faculty members may borrow five (5) books for two (2) weeks renewable only once.
Faculty members from the branch can only photocopy books that are found in the library.
SHS faculty members may borrow three (3) books for a week, Renewable once.
C. Employees
Employees may borrow three (3) books for a week, renewable only once.
Employees from the branch can only photocopy books that are found in the library.
D. Alumni / Visiting Users
Alumni / Visiting Users can have access to library materials but STRICTLY for ROOM USE - only.
Requirements:
For Alumni: Alumni ID
For Visiting Users: Referral Letter from their Chief Librarian and a fee of fifty pesos (P50.00) payable at the Bursar's Office.
E. Photocopy
Photocopying of books / periodicals is limited to twenty (20) minutes.
F. Fines and Penalties for defaced, mutilated and lost borrowed library materials
Students with overdue books will be charged ten pesos (P10.00) / book / day including Saturdays, Sundays and Holidays payable at the Bursar's Office.
Faculty members & employees will be charged twenty pesos (P20.00) / book / day payable at the Bursar's Office.
If the pages are slightly torn, upon the return of the book, a fine of one hundred pesos (P100.00) will be charged payable at the Bursar's Office.
If the pages are severely torn, upon the return of the book, a replacement of the same or its latest edition is required within a week plus, one hundred pesos (P100.00) processing fee payable at the Bursar's Office. Borrowers who do not replace the book will not be issued clearance.
A lost book while out on loan must be replaced with the same title within a week plus one hundred pesos (P100.00) processing fee.
G. Library Service
Two weeks before the final examinations, all books shall be for room use only.
Reader's services shall cease 15 minutes before the indicated closing time to enable the library staff to put their area in order for the next day's operation.
In units where an open-shelf system is adopted, library users are required to deposit their personal things, except money and valuables, at the baggage / control counters.
Library Clearance - is secured by all faculty members every end of a semester / summer, by all regular employees who will be on leave for a month or a longer period, and by all students when they apply for their academic documents.
H. Instructional Media Materials
Faculty members must fill up the instructional Media Resources Reservation Form.
Availability for the use of the viewing room is on a first - come - first - serve basis.
I. Conduct inside the Library
A quiet atmosphere conducive to serious study and learning must be observed at all times. Unnecessary noise, loud conversation and discussion must be avoided.
All belongings should not be left unattended. Librarians & staff will not be responsible for safekeeping.
Anyone creating excessive noise and disturbance that disrupts the normal operations of the library will be asked to leave.
Eating, drinking and littering inside the library are strictly prohibited.
Writing on books and other library materials; as well as on the tables and chairs, theft and destruction of library properties are also prohibited and are subject to disciplinary action.
Mobile phones must be in a non-audible ring setting (vibrate).
Students showing PDA are not allowed in the library.
Harassment of library staff and use of abusive and lewd language are also strictly prohibited.
